WebMar 9, 2024 · At the shoulder, grey wolves average a height of 26 to 32 inches. Even the smaller end of the adult range is larger than that of the coyote, which averages 21 to 24 inches at the shoulder. The same is true of the length measured from the nose to the tip of the tail. Coyotes max out at about 4.5 feet, while wolves average 4.5 to 6.5 feet in length. Due to coyote’s body size, they have the ability to kill deer while foxes are not … engineer branch manager armyHow can a layman with no particular wildlife training tell the difference between a fox and a coyote? Location is generally the easiest way. If you’re living outside of North America, then you’re almost certainly dealing with a fox, because coyotes have a restricted range.
